BEFORE YOU CALL

PROBLEM

CAUSE

CORRECTION

DISPENSER (Ice & Water) (Continued)
Dispenser will

not dispense

water.

• Dispenser lock out is

engaged.

• Water filter not seated

properly.

• Water filter is clogged.

• Household water line

valve is not open.

• Press and hold control lock for three (3)

seconds.

• Remove and reinstall the water filter. Be sure

to push the filter firmly so that you hear it

lock solidly into position.

• Replace filter cartridge. Be sure to remove

protective caps and push the filter firmly so

that you hear it lock solidly into position.

• Open household water line valve. See CON-

CERN column AUTOMATIC ICE MAKER.

Water has an

odd taste and/

or odor.

• Water has not been

dispensed for an

extended period of

time.

• Unit not properly con-

nected to cold water

line.

• Draw and discard 10-12 glasses of water to

freshen the supply.

• Connect unit to cold water line that supplies

water to the kitchen faucet.

Water pressure

is extremely

low.

• Cut-off and cut-on

pressures are too low

(well systems only).

• Reverse osmosis sys-

tem is in regenerative

phase.

• Have someone turn up the cut-off and cut-on

pressure on the water pump system (well

systems only).

• It is normal for a reverse osmosis system

to be below 20 psi during the regenerative

phase.

Water not cold

enough.

• As warmer tap water

goes through the filter

and enters the water

tank the chilled water

is pushed through to

the dispenser. Once

the chilled water is

used up it will take

several hours to bring

the freshly replaced

water to a cooler

temperature.

• Add ice to cup or container before dispensing

water.

OPENING/CLOSING OF DOORS/DRAWERS
Door(s) will not

close.

• Door was closed too

hard, causing other

door to open slightly.

• Refrigerator is not

level. It rocks on the

floor when moved

slightly.

• Refrigerator is touch-

ing a wall or cabinet.

• Close both doors gently.

• Ensure floor is level and solid, and can

adequately support the refrigerator. Contact

a carpenter to correct a sagging or sloping

floor.

• Ensure floor is level and solid, and can

adequately support the refrigerator. Contact

a carpenter to correct a sagging or sloping

floor.

Drawers are

difficult to

move.

• Food is touching shelf

on top of drawer.

• Track that drawers

slide on is dirty.

• Remove top layer of items in drawer.

• Ensure drawer is properly installed on track.

• Clean drawer, rollers, and track. See Care &

Cleaning.
